When Do You Need Urgent Structural Consulting?
Don't ignore the signs your building or structure is giving you. Contact us if you observe:
- Appearance or growth of cracks in walls, beams, or slabs.
- Concrete spalling exposing rusted reinforcement.
- Visible deformations or "deflections" in beams or balconies.
- An ITE (Technical Building Inspection) with unfavorable results in the structural section.
- The need to increase the load capacity of a floor slab for a new use.
A timely diagnosis is the best guarantee of safety and can save you significantly higher costs in the future.
